- Switched to portalocker for locking files (Windows compatibility).
[1.18.58]
Added
- Added nbest translation, exposed as
--nbest-size. Nbest translation means to not only output the most probable translation according to a model, but the top n most probable hypotheses. If--nbest-size > 1and the option--output-typeis not explicitly specified, the output type will be changed to one JSON list of nbest translations per line.--nbest-sizecan never be larger than--beam-size.
Changed
- Changed
sockeye.rerankCLI to be compatible with nbest translation JSON output format.

[1.18.35]
Added
- ROUGE scores are now available in
sockeye-evaluate. - Enabled CHRF as an early-stopping metric.
- Added support for
--beam-search-stop firstfor decoding jobs with--batch-size > 1. - Now supports negative constraints, which are phrases that must not appear in the output.
- Global constraints can be listed in a (pre-processed) file, one per line:
--avoid-list FILE - Per-sentence constraints are passed using the
avoidkeyword in the JSON object, with a list of strings as its field value.
- Global constraints can be listed in a (pre-processed) file, one per line:
- Added option to pad vocabulary to a multiple of x: e.g.
--pad-vocab-to-multiple-of 16. - Pre-training the RNN decoder. Usage:
- Train with flag
--decoder-only. - Feed identical source/target training data.
- Train with flag
Fixed
- Preserving max output length for each sentence to allow having identical translations for both with and without batching.
Changed
- No longer restrict the vocabulary to 50,000 words by default, but rather create the vocabulary from all words which occur at least
--word-min-counttimes. Specifying--num-wordsexplicitly will still lead to a restricted
vocabulary.
